site stats

Flutter change widget properties

WebJan 27, 2024 · Solution 1: Create a global instance of _MyHomePageState. Use this instance in _SubState as _myHomePageState.setState. … WebAug 29, 2024 · Make MyScrollView a Stateful Widget. Edit: Initialize _currentIndex to 0 and use setState to change it to 1 whenever the user click on the FAB. If your trying to update the data from another class then check the below link:

How to add icon property in button widget using class in flutter

WebApr 8, 2024 · A platonic widget that calls a closure to obtain its child widget. It is convenient anytime you need logic to build a widget, it avoids the need to create a dedicated function. You use the Builder widget as the child, you provide your logic in its builder method: Center( child: Builder( builder: (context) { // any logic needed... WebAdd a comment. 1. if you just want a message you can use tooltip attribute that is already inside IconButton () like this. IconButton ( icon: Image.asset ('img/performance.png'), onPressed: () { print ('Favorite'); }, tooltip: 'Favorite') if you want a color change on hover you can change hoverColor attribute like this. ea nhl online https://yahangover.com

How can i dynamically change the properties of a widget?

WebJan 12, 2024 · Does Flutter renders a completely new Map Widget every 15sec with new NewLocationState or similar to React, Flutter can compare the changes in some kind of virtual tree and only change the properties in an existing Map which is efficient and should cause less memory consumption. Web// To perform an interaction with a widget in your test, use the WidgetTester // utility that Flutter provides. For example, you can send tap and scroll // gestures. You can also use WidgetTester to find child widgets in the widget // tree, read text, and verify that the values of widget properties are correct. import 'package:flutter/material ... ea nhl on pc

How can i dynamically change the properties of a widget?

Category:rest_API_demo/widget_test.dart at master · flutter …

Tags:Flutter change widget properties

Flutter change widget properties

What is the Widget Breaking Changes in Flutter?

WebJan 28, 2024 · Solution 1: Create a global instance of _MyHomePageState. Use this instance in _SubState as _myHomePageState.setState. Solution 2: No need to create a global instance. Instead, just pass the parent instance to the child widget. Solution 3: Passing a callback from parent widget to child widget to update state of parent widget … WebApr 10, 2024 · Step 2: Add the ThemeData class as the theme parameter inside the MaterialApp widget. Step 3: Add the appBarTheme parameter inside the ThemeData …

Flutter change widget properties

Did you know?

WebApr 17, 2024 · For example the widget "IgnorePointer", which have a property "ignoring" that can be either true or false. but i want to change and access this property dynamically. if the ignoring is true, then i want its child color to be different otherwise normal. and on a … WebMar 27, 2024 · A widget-breaking change is a change made to a widget that alters its behavior and may cause an application to malfunction if not updated. These changes are usually made to improve the performance or functionality of a widget. Some examples of widget-breaking changes in Flutter include changes to the widget’s properties or the …

WebMar 3, 2024 · In Flutter lots of layout related tasks use widgets instead of setting properties. Remember, a widget is a blueprint that affects how the UI looks. Replace the myWidget () method with the following: Widget myWidget() { return Padding( // Set the padding using the EdgeInsets widget. // The value 16.0 means 16 logical pixels. Web5 Answers. You can use tester and find to obtain anything in the widget tree. For example, if you want to test that a Text has the property textAlign set to TextAlign.center, you can do: expect ( tester.widget (find.byType (Text)), isA ().having ( (t) => t.textAlign, 'textAlign', TextAlign.center), ); It's working with textAlign but with ...

WebIn Flutter, you can think of a single frame as a static configuration of a widget tree. An animation is a sequence of frames that, when rapidly displayed over time, creates the illusion of motion. In Flutter, an animation changes a widget property value between frames to create the illusion of motion. WebJun 20, 2024 · 1. The MyApp class extends StatefulWidget, which means this widget stores mutable state. When the MyApp widget is first inserted into the tree, the framework calls the createState () function to create a fresh instance of _MyAppState to associate with that location in the tree. (Notice that subclasses of State are typically named with leading ...

WebStatefulWidget. class. A widget that has mutable state. State is information that (1) can be read synchronously when the widget is built and (2) might change during the lifetime of …

WebHow to change a widget Step 1: Select widget In the screen design hierarchy, go to the widget you wish to modify. Step 2: Select new widget Just erase the widget name and … csrd and third countriesWebIn the left panel, there’s a portion of the Flutter widget tree under investigation, starting from the root. When you tap a specific widget in the tree, ... You can’t alter the state or properties of this widget once built. When your properties don’t need to change over time, it’s generally a good idea to start with a stateless widget. csrd and secWebDec 8, 2024 · Scaffold is a class in flutter which provides many widgets or we can say APIs like Drawer, Snack-Bar, Bottom-Navigation-Bar, Floating-Action-Button, App-Bar, etc. Scaffold will expand or occupy the whole device screen. It will occupy the available space. Scaffold will provide a framework to implement the basic material design layout of the … ea nhl server locationsWebStateless Vs Stateful Widgets. What is Flutter? Flutter is an open-source mobile app development framework developed by Google that allows developers to build native-quality applications for iOS, Android, the web, and desktop platforms from a single codebase. ea nhl 23 ps5WebApr 10, 2024 · Step 2: Add the ThemeData class as the theme parameter inside the MaterialApp widget. Step 3: Add the appBarTheme parameter inside the ThemeData class and assign the AppBarTheme class to it. Step 4: In the AppBarTheme, include a color property and assign a desired color. MaterialApp(. title: 'Flutter Demo', csrd annual reportWebSep 22, 2024 · bool _val = true; Container ( child: _val ? button1 ( // when _val is true button1 will be the child of container. So it will be visible. onPressed: () { _val = !_val; setState ( () { }); }) : button2 (), // when _val is false button2 will be the child of container. So it will be visible. ); First of all, you need to make sure that the class ... csrd and griWebShort Answer. You can access the icons dynamically by passing the Unicode int value of the icon to the FontAwesome IconDataSolid widget. int unicodeIconString = 0xf1b9; Icon (IconDataSolid (unicodeIconString)) eangee leaf lamps